Six Dead and Several Injured in Lightning Strikes Across Jharkhand

Analysed 29 Jun 2026·4 sources analysed·Jharkhand, India·generic
Six Dead and Several Injured in Lightning Strikes Across JharkhandPreviousNext

In Jharkhand, lightning strikes over the past two days have resulted in at least six deaths and multiple injuries across several districts. Victims include a three-year-old girl, two minors, and adults engaged in outdoor activities such as farming and fruit picking. Incidents occurred in Ranchi, Garhwa, Gumla, West Singhbhum, and Lohardaga districts. Authorities reported that injured individuals are receiving medical treatment, while investigations continue into the circumstances of the strikes.
